There are twelve signs of the zodiac. How many people must be present for there to be at least a 50% chance that two or more of
Nutka1998 [239]

Answer:

5

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that each zodiac sign occupies 1/12 of a year.

Then the minimum number of persons for Y[all different signs] < 0.5,

The probability of at least two having the same sign is 1 minus the probability of all having different signs.

This can be represented as A [at least 2 person share the same sign] = 1 - Y[all different signs] must be > 0.5

Therefore we have 1 - 12/12 *11/12 * 10/12 *9/12 *8/12 = 0.38

This implies that the lowest number will be found to be 5

Hence, the correct answer is 5.
